Location: Minnesota Rep Power: 7 ![]() | bcms vu with S8500 I have a G3r at my main location, and a G3si at one of my remotes. Both are connected to the PSTN via PRI. I am able to receive calls where the calling party's name is displayed, however, I cannot get the two above mentioned systems to display caller name when a DID is dialed from location to location. Any suggestions? I have all trunk groups set up with 'send name' set to Y. If I change 'send number' to N, I can see that reflected, but no change with 'send name'. Also, when I call from one of my test stations to my main station, via PSTN, only number is carried..... Tim | ||||||||

Location: Chicago area (Lombard) Rep Power: 6 ![]() | Hi Tim, We have a Definity G3i connected to two G3si. We also use PRI to connect the main G3i to the two G3si's. We are also using DCS between the main switch and the two remote switches. For that we have two hunt groups for each site, one for voice and the other for data. I am guessing that this is not the way you have it set up. We can dial DID numbers of people (4 digit only) and through the udp routing, it comes up with name and number on the display (8410D).
